iPhone loses its top spot in China: iPhones is known as the top selling smartphones in China since 2012. This crown is no longer with Apple because it is taken by Android. According to the new reports from Counterpoint Research, Oppo's R9 has taken the lead in top selling smartphone in China. The report says that 17 million R9 units were sold in China last year. These numbers are equal to 4% of the market share. In comparison, Apple managed to sell only 12 million units of the iPhone 6s, which is only 2% of the market. The report also says that Oppo's shipments in China increased by 106% whereas Apple's flagship declined by 21%. Source: http://tecupdates.com/iphone-loses-its-top-spot-in-china/

Samsung Sales in Q4 2016: Samsung announced its sales report of Quarter 2016. Although Note 7 incident was a mess but the Korean giant managed to sell 90 million smartphones and 8 million tablets in 2016. Their sales report mentioned $18.8 billion sales revenue for the IT & Mobile Communications and $2 billion operational profit. Looks like Note 7 did not affect Samsung sales at all. Causes of Note 7 Battery fires - Samsung details: Today, Samsung mobile business chief Dong-jin Koh identified what went wrong with their Galaxy Note 7 handsets who caught fire. Samsung recalled all Note 7 all around the world due to this mishap, which is said to be worst technology, recalls in recent times. The conference held in Seoul, South Korea today (23 rd  Jan 2017). Dong-jin Koh, apologize to customers and suppliers. The Galaxy Note 7 handsets were packed with lithium-ion batteries, which are arranged in three layers: Positive electrode, Negative electrode Physical layer that acted as the separator between the first two. When the positive and negative electrodes touch, it can sometimes lead to short circuits within the battery cells. Koh clarified in the primary set of batteries, which were moved out with the original Note 7, there was a problem with the upper right corner of the battery cell. Google Play vs App Store: We just received a report of app revenue related to two largest app stores, Google Play by Android and App Store by Apple. Apple’s revenue reached $5.4 billion in Q4 of 2016. It’s 60% increase year on year. As market share of Google is more than Apple, we could see that Google's Play Store is enjoying an even more growth which is 82% compared to the same period of 2015 but is still trailing the App Store in absolute figures. It is $3.3 billion total which is less than what Apple's store generated the year before. If we talk about the total platforms combined, the numbers are $8.7 billion which is 67% increase. 19.2 billion app installs were estimated to have taken place in Q4 2016 and that's a more modest 17% increase compared to the same period of 2015. Nokia 6 hands on: Nokia is back in the game and announced it’s mid-range smartphone Nokia 6 (Exclusively in China). The phone is approximately cost $250 providing aluminum body. Here under Nokia 6 latest images we received. Nokia 6 Specs: The phone is packed with interesting features starting from Android Nougat 7.0. Nokia 6 has Snapdragon 430 chipset which is an octa-core Cortex-A53 with Adreno 505 GPU and 4GB of RAM. It’s screen is 5.5” (1080 HD screen) with curved 2.5D Gorilla Glass sheet. Nokia 6 offers 16MP rear camera with F/2.0 lens. If we talk about the front it has 8MP camera with the same aperture. Internal memory is 64GB which is enough for your media files and photos.
